Nick Saban said Wednesday that safety Malachi Moore and punter James Burnip may or may not play when Arkansas visits Alabama for an 11 AM CT Saturday game, calling both "game-time decisions.'

Speaking on the weekly SEC coaches teleconference, Saban added that Alabama is preparing as if  Moore and James Burnip will not play against Arkansas, but they both could depending on how their injuries progress.

The Bama coach also said that receiver Ja'Corey Brooks has been able to practice this week. Brooks was on the field for the first kick return of the game in Saturday's win at Texas A&M but was replaced by running back Roydell Williams and later not spotted on the sidelines.

If Burnip can't play, will Will Reichard again step in? Maybe. Probably. However, little-known walk-on Nick Serpa is Alabama's other punter, if Burnip can't play and the Tide chooses not to use Reichard on punts again.

On another note, Saban said he's having fun this season. "This has been a very enjoyable, challenging year. We've got a different kind of team," he said.
